An attacker with a knife killed at least three people and wounded several others at a church in the French city of Nice on Thursday, French officials said, in an incident the city’s mayor described as an act of “terrorism”.

Mayor Christian Estrosi said on Twitter the attacker had been arrested. French media said the suspect was in hospital.

Estrosi said one of the victims was killed in “horrible” way, “like the professor” – an apparent reference to the attack on French teacher Samuel Paty, who was beheaded in broad daylight earlier this month.

The exact motive of the attack was unclear.

The incident comes amid growing tensions between France and the Muslim world over French President Emmanuel Macron’s recent speech wherein he said Islam was in “crisis”, and amid renewed public support in France for the right to show caricatures of the Prophet Muhammad.

The caricatures, which are deeply offensive to Muslims, are part of a renewed debate on freedom of expression after Paty’s killing.
